Hamill Concrete is seeking General Laborers, Form Setters, Crew Leads, and Foreman for a residential poured wall/foundation crew. Hamill Concrete is a residential poured wall company. We currently install foundations for DR Horton, Pulte Homes, Stonegate/Gonyea Homes and Centra Homes. We also work for many custom builders like Moderno Companies, Sustainable 9, and Laketown Builders. No experience is necessary to start at $18 per hour. Job Responsibilities Form, pour, and strip footings Form, pour, and strip walls Bend rebar for walls Assist with layout Set panels quickly and correctly Install ledge and block downs String and straighten forms Teach and lead new employees Strip walls quickly and efficiently Must be willing to work in and maintain a positive attitude in adverse weather conditions Possess thorough knowledge of concrete installation and finishing to perform the necessary physical tasks at all work sites.
